DV19 HPC is a 2019 Fiat Panda in Yellow with a 1,242c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 5 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.

Across all 2019 Fiat Panda models, the average MOT pass rate is 87.2% with a typical mileage of 20,038 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Fiat Panda f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 66,636 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DV19 HPC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Panda typ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 7 years old, this Fiat Panda is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
